Conclusion
Shimano AERO XR C5000X edges out Daiwa 20 Legalis LT 3000-CX with slightly better overall performance, especially on the total score (7.92 out of 10) and the ball bearings (5+1). Still, Daiwa 20 Legalis LT 3000-CX holds its own with strengths like a gear ratio of 5.3:1 and a ergonomics of 6.3 out of 10, making it a solid choice depending on your preferences and fishing needs.
